One year O-A extension in Phuket Town

Can anyone tell me if I can extend my one retirement visa 45 days in advance at Phuket Town, or is 30 days the max?

Also, I have seen a few conflicting posts on what is required for Proof of Residence, some say TM30 needed, others say Phuket has their own "special" form. Does anyone have any recent experience with proof of residence requirements?

30 days is the typical extension date. Although I once got one 60 days out when I explained I was leaving got attend my daughter's graduation. They made a one time exception and they said please don't ask again. So if you have a really good reason that they accept, they may make an exception. Good luck!

30 day was the norm but those days you can do it up to 45 days before the expire date.

I suppose that you mean the address registration (proof of residence is not required for a extension but to buy a car etc)

Both forms are excepted but normally private registrars are using the local form at the immigration office.
